Congratulations! The members of your club have chosen You to lead them to accomplish a set of goals.
Do what is best for the organization Don’t try to please everyone Look for solutions It is neither "your way" nor "my way" but the best way. Leadership Is Not A Popularity Contest.
You do not have all the answers. Keep an open mind. Consider fresh ideas. Leaders Are Stimulating
Be a “Champion of Change.” Challenge the members to find new approaches to challenges. Don’t accept the status quo. Don’t repeat past mistakes. Leaders Are Innovative
Involve everyone. Delegate jobs and duties. Ask and they will give. Leaders Are Influential
Keep the goal in mind. Look for win-win solutions. Leaders Are Diplomatic
Inspire your members to take ownership. This is not Myclub, it is Ourclub Leaders Are Inspirational
